** The kitchen remodeling market in Delano is characterized by a mix of local, versatile handymen and specialized tradespeople (like countertop fabricators and tile setters). Due to the city's size, there are fewer large, dedicated kitchen and bath remodeling firms compared to major metropolitan areas. Many Delano residents seeking full-scale, high-end renovations often look to established contractors in Bakersfield, who regularly service the entire Central Valley. The competition level is moderate, with a focus on value and personal service. Pricing is generally more affordable than the state average, with mid-range full kitchen remodels typically starting in the $15,000 - $35,000 range, depending on the materials (e.g., stock vs. custom cabinets, quartz vs. granite) and the scope of electrical/plumbing work. The most successful local providers are those with a long-standing community presence and a reputation for reliability and quality craftsmanship.

For a full remodel in Delano, homeowners can expect a typical range of $25,000 to $60,000+, depending on the scope and material choices. Key local cost factors include the need for potential plumbing updates in older homes, the cost of transporting materials to the Central Valley, and choosing finishes that can withstand our hot, dry summers. Labor rates in Kern County are generally more favorable than in major coastal metros, but material costs are largely consistent statewide.
A full kitchen remodel typically takes 6 to 12 weeks from demolition to completion. In Delano, the best time to schedule is during the drier months of late spring or early fall to avoid potential delays from rare but impactful Central Valley rainstorms. Summer projects are common, but contractors may have busier schedules, so planning and booking early is crucial.
Yes, permits from the City of Delano Building & Safety Division are typically required for structural, electrical, and plumbing changes. Important local considerations include compliance with California's strict Title 24 energy codes (affecting lighting and windows) and, for homes with older plumbing, potential updates to meet current water conservation standards. Always verify your contractor will pull the necessary permits.
